Brescia have released a statement distancing themselves from Mario Balotelli’s comments about Juventus, although he assures it was only a joke.

The striker said during an Instagram live chat that Serie A played the remaining fixtures from Week 26, including Juventus 2-0 Inter, because they “had to wait until Juventus went back on top before stopping the league.”

Brescia released a statement this evening noting the club “wished to officially distance itself from the comments made by their player Mario Balotelli, relative to hypothetical favouritism in Serie A.

“Specifically, Mario Balotelli during an Instagram live transmission repeated on YouTube, made comments today that alluded to ‘favours’ for a team (Juventus) in the running for the title.

“Brescia Calcio underline that such insinuations are strictly personal and are in no way representative of the Club.”

Balotelli had already posted another message on his Instagram Stories assuring it was in no way an insult towards Juventus, nor an insinuation, but rather a joke.

“They had to play because Juventus had a game in hand, that’s all!”
